It is available now as a dealer installed option.
As of March it will be incorporated from the company directly. Meaning it will be an option you can get when you order your car. Where as now you need to go to the parts department order the Ipod Most Adapter and then have it installed by the dealer which will run you about 500$ installed whereas as of March i think the option from Bmw will be about 300$ and your car will come with it directly. |
